But Theistic beliefs are harder to quash than cockroaches. There's practically no convincing many Theists and, unfortunately, they simply believe because they were taught to believe. Will that ever really change?
That core problem is unlikely to change, but I think it's getting harder and harder to do it. The internet especially makes insulating people from different viewpoints (and fact checking) extremely difficult. There seems to be a drift towards more liberal theists, with the doctrine being watered down a bit more each generation. That's in (most) civilised countries, anyway.
Sadly in some places they will still disown, beat or even kill you for daring to be different. That's the last refuge of religion I think. The rest of it won't entirely go away, but I believe it will get diluted into obscurity in time. Feel free to send me a private message.

What presumption..
Just because one can not verify or falsify a claim does not mean the claim is not verifiable or unfashionable. It simply means that individual is not in a position to do so. Thus that person my rely/have faith in those who do until he himself can verify or falsify a claim IF that day EVER comes. Example: Can Anyone of you PERSONALLY Verify that we did or did not goto the moon based on you own life experience? I'm not talking about watching a video or touching a rock in a museum. I am asking how many astronauts are here who have set foot on the moon? Yet as a country we (for the most non crazy part) can accept that we indeed set foot on the moon solely based on what others experienced and witnessed for themselves but we ourselves did not. Or better yet how many of you can take a sample of something and carbon date it yourself, with the stuff you have at home? what about DNA? how many of you have mapped the human genome personally and can personally draw parallels between it and our closest Simeon relative? So then how does the faith we have in our space program or 'science' at large differ FOR THOSE who are asked to simply believe what they are told is true by 'science?' In how this relates to the video how does the "ridiculous claim" in the video when it pertains to God, become trivial? But, when a similar claim like we landed on the moon is taken as gospel truth IF INFACT The SAME MEASURE OF FAITH IS REQUIRED FOR BOTH TO BE ACCEPTED? Again, you haven't yourself been to the moon, you can't carbon date, you can't map a genome I would be willing to bet the farm you can not do/personally verify 1/3 of the things you accept as fact/truth, yet you have FAITH in those who can and do. Yet when this SAME EXACT measure of faith is required by God before He will open the gates of heaven to flood you with all the Personal evidence you would ever need (He do the equivalent of taking you to the moon) you 'smaart' people mock the very type faith you have in science when you are asked to put it in God. In order for this video to have any merrit No one Ever could have had any experience with God. Yet look at how you all support it.. On FAITH. |
